  1. The national flag of Denmark (Danish: Dannebrog, pronounced [ˈtænəˌpʁoˀ]) is red with a white Nordic cross, which means that the cross extends to the edges of the flag and the vertical part of the cross is shifted to the hoist side.

    Copenhagen [9] ( Danish: København [kʰøpm̩ˈhɑwˀn] ⓘ) is the capital and most populous city of Denmark, with a population of approximately 660,000 in the municipality and 1.4 million in the urban area. [10] [11] The city is situated on the islands of Zealand and Amager, separated from Malmö, Sweden, by the Øresund strait.

  4. What is the Copenhagen Flag? Copenhagen, the capital of Denmark, does not actually have its own a city flag. There is therefore no Copenhagen flag as such. The capital city does however proudly display the Dannebrog as its own, and you will see it in public places all over town when visiting Copenhagen.

  5. The flag of Denmark, otherwise known as the Dannebrog, has a bright red background and a white Scandinavian cross. The Scandinavian or Nordic cross appears all over the Scandinavian map, as well as in regions elsewhere in the world too.

  6. Did you know. The name of the Danish flag is Dannebrog. This probably means “the cloth of the Danes”. The Danish flag was not always Danish. During the European crusades from the 11th to 13th centuries, a red flag with a white cross was used frequently, without connection to Denmark.

  7. Apr 25, 2024 · Copenhagen, capital and largest city of Denmark. It is located on the islands of Zealand and Amager, at the southern end of The Sound. A small village existed on the site of the present city by the early 10th century.
